Product Overview
iLite® GM-CSF Assay Ready Cells are a genetically engineered reporter gene cell line (U937) responsive to granulocyte-macrophage colony-stimulating factor (GM-CSF) by specific and proportional expression of Firefly Luciferase.
They can be used for the quantification GM-CSF activity, GM-CSF inhibitor activity, and for determination of neutralizing antibodies against such either in buffer systems or human serum.
As a functional assay, iLite GM-CSF assay ready cells can be used to determine the activity of GM-CSF, or of GM-CSF inhibitors, as well as neutralizing antibodies, all using the same assay set-up.
The assay ready iLite GM-CSF cells Normalization of cell counts and serum matrix effects is obtained by a second reporter gene, a Renilla Luciferase reporter gene construct, under the control of a constitutive promotor.
